$8.00 per day

Valid in any general unmarked

stall

Valid in non-24 hour “AR”

reserved stalls after 5:00pm

Monday – Friday and ALL day

Saturday and Sunday.

Not valid in Metered, Pay-by-

Space, Service, X, or Disabled

stalls.

Can be bought using a credit card

General Permit (DGEN)

$5.00

Can be sold to staff, students

or patrons who have a valid

commuter permit.

Can only park in AR stalls in

their designated zones.

Commuter Plus (PLUS)

$16.00 per day

Valid in general unmarked stalls.

Send patrons with large these

permits to park in an open lot.

If Bus, call supervisor for

instruction on best lot.

Bus/Oversized Vehicle

$13.00 per day

One day reserved permit.

Valid from 7:00am-11:59pm in any

AR reserved.

Not valid in Metered, Pay by

Space; E-plate, “X”, Service or

Disabled stalls.

Can be bought using a credit card.

VIP Permit (DVIP)

$15.00 per day

Valid in service stalls and general

stalls.

They are not to be sold to staff or

students.

Ask for a business card from the

patron.

Can be bought using a credit card.

Service Permit (DSVC)

Free for staff.

This button shows up on the kiosk

screen from 11:45am to 2:00pm.

Allows a staff commuter permit-

holder to park in the AR stalls.

They must choose which lot they

want to park in.

Must have a valid staff commuter

permit hanging.

Enter in the hang tag number and

select the designated lot.

Staff Commuter + (PLUS)

$2.00 per hour

Enter the amount of money.

– Ex: 3 hours = $6

Instruct them to park in an

unmarked stall (not the pay-

by-space parking area).

Inform them of expiration time.

CASH ONLY!!

General Short Term (SST)

$1.00

Must have a valid monthly Medical

Center permit.

Allows UCI Medical Center patrons

to park on the UCI campus

Valid in general stalls.

Type the letter “B” and entering their

permit number

Make sure that they have the

monthly permit and NOT the daily

permit.

Medical Center B (MB)

Medical Center B (MB)

$10.00

The on-duty supervisor will notify the

attendant if these permits will be

used.

Treated like general permits.

Valid in any general unmarked stall

and in non-24 hour “AR” stalls after

5PM Monday – Friday and all day

Saturday and Sunday.

Can be bought using a credit card.

Event Permit (EVNT)

Emergency

Situations

Panic Buttons

Each kiosk (other than

University Kiosk) has a

Panic Button.

Located next to the cash

register.

In place to aid you in an

extreme emergency.

UCIPD will be notified and

police will come to assist if

pushed.

AccidentsNotify the supervisor of

accidents, especially of

emergency vehicles or traffic

violations.

Remain in the kiosk if it is safe.

Generally, NEVER LEAVE

YOUR KIOSK

If you need to leave, lock the

cash tray and notify the

supervisor.

Medical Emergencies

Call for help on the phone or

use the orange button on the

radio.

Use the panic button.

Do not leave your kiosk, inform

the supervisor immediately.

If you do help, always lock

your cash box tray and inform

the supervisor.

Injuries

Notify the supervisor of the

severity of the injuries.

Use emergency precautions

such as the orange button,

panic button, code 999.

Do not leave your kiosk.

If you do leave your kiosk,

lock up the cash box.

Police or Fire Personnel

Police and Fire trucks will

pass your kiosk for

emergencies.

ONLY notify your

supervisor when the police

cars or fire trucks are

blocking traffic.

Notify your supervisor of

your location and the

severity of the situation.
